Output 3ef53bca01eecb380fa1f7dff0947bf58b4ee54142e433bd9c722d1cb651d87f:0

value
7909353549
script pubkey
OP_0 OP_PUSHBYTES_20 ebe4e88aeb88a15fa9b94988c86fa5a6e4d5d170
address
bc1qa0jw3zht3zs4l2defxyvsma95mjdt5tsjejw8c
transaction
3ef53bca01eecb380fa1f7dff0947bf58b4ee54142e433bd9c722d1cb651d87f
confirmations
240759
spent
true